rockster_duplex_crusherJuly 16, 2014, Fort Wayne, Ind. – Rockster Recycler North
America introduces its mobile, patented Duplex System, a track-mounted crushing
plant that allows the contractor to interchange an impact crusher with a jaw
crusher, and vice-versa, on the same chassis.

 

This capability creates a dual-purpose machine for a wider
range of recycle, demolition and aggregate crushing applications. Available in
the R1100/1200 impact/jaw models and the R900/800 impact/jaw models, the Duplex
System allows one crusher unit to exchange with the other crusher unit in
approximately four to five hours using an excavator. An overnight exchange of
crusher units on the plant by a maintenance crew means the plant can be on the
jobsite and ready to crush by morning. The R1100/1200 processes 280 to 350 tons
per hour; the R900/800 processes 120 to 240 tons per hour.

Rockster Recycler’s horizontal shaft impact crushers feature
two hydraulically adjustable swing-beams, as well as on-the-fly rotor speed
adjustment for accurate material sizing and fines control. A large rotor with
four-bar hammer can be positioned in two-high and two-low or all four-high
configuration. The hydraulically adjustable jaw crushers feature oversize
bearings and shafts and are reversible to easily remove uncrushables.

 

The plants’ drive system is located at the rear of the
machine, enclosed in a sound-proofed housing. For maintenance and service
purposes, the casing can be opened completely on all sides. The hydraulic pump
for all auxiliary drives, as well as the pump for the hydrostat, are driven via
a distributing gear unit, which is flange-mounted on the drive motor. The
hydrostat activates the crusher via a v-belt drive and allows adjustment of the
crusher speed, replacing the typical clutch. The bypass chute is adjustable,
allowing the discharged pre-screened material to be directed to either a side
or main discharge belt. This option can be controlled with an easy-to-use hand
gear. Both the main and side discharge belts are hydraulically operated and
fold for compact transport.
